Abstract
The utility model relates to a pipe-bending machine with a magnetic clutch. The pipe-bending machine with the magnetic clutch comprises a frame (1), a wheel (2) installed on the frame (1), a locking device (3), a movable shaft (4), a gearbox (5) and a magnetic clutch motor (6). The movable shaft (4) is connected with the magnetic clutch motor (6), and the gearbox (5) is arranged between the magnetic clutch motor (6) and the movable shaft (4). The pipe-bending machine with the magnetic clutch adopts the magnetic clutch motor to solve the problems that the operating speed of the main shaft of a normal pipe-bending machine is fast, the torsion of the main shaft of the normal pipe-bending machine is small, and the shutting down of the normal pipe-bending machine is not timely. And meanwhile the pipe-bending machine with the magnetic clutch improves the rate of once forming of products, guarantees the quality of the products, and saves cost.
Description
Technical field
The utility model relates to a kind of angle pipe equipment, is specifically related to a kind of magnetic-clutch bending machine.
Background technology
The existing bending machine that uses is mainly used in the not high tubing of middle pipe with small pipe diameter and required precision.For precision prescribed in the bending of high and Large Diameter Pipeline copper pipe, require the spindle operation speed of bending machine slower, torsion is larger, stopping must be in time, the motor that existing bending machine adopts, when crooked pipe with small pipe diameter tubing, power output is excessive, because inertia can not in time stop, cause the crook excessive, otherwise when curved major diameter tubing, output power of motor is inadequate, just must be by manpower, because the people is limited in scope to the control dynamics, thus very difficult curved to accurate location, so bend pipe is second-rate, and inefficiency during bend pipe, manpower consumption is large.
Existing enterprise for improving the quality of products and class, must solve existing bending machine torsion large not aborning, and the untimely shortcoming of stopping improves quality and precision that the Large Diameter Pipeline copper pipe bends, but there is no the report of this kind equipment in prior art.
The utility model content
In view of this, the purpose of this utility model is for deficiency of the prior art, and a kind of magnetic-clutch bending machine is provided, with the torsion that increases bending machine with bend precision, solve general elbow machine torsion large not, the untimely problem of stopping, improve the product size precision, guarantee product quality.
For completing above-mentioned purpose, the technical solution adopted in the utility model is: a kind of magnetic-clutch bending machine, comprise framework and be arranged on wheel, locking device, movable axis, gearbox and motor on framework, it is characterized in that: described motor adopts the magnetic-clutch motor, described movable axis connects the magnetic-clutch motor, is provided with gearbox between magnetic-clutch motor and movable axis.
Compared with prior art, the beneficial effects of the utility model are: 1. torsion is large, and size Control is accurate, has solved simultaneously the problem of the curved minor radius of major diameter copper pipe; 2. operating efficiency and product quality have been improved; 3. more easily control of operation reduces personnel cost.

The specific embodiment
Magnetic-clutch bending machine as shown in Figure 1 is comprised of framework 1, wheel 2, locking device 3, movable axis 4, gearbox 5 and magnetic-clutch motor 6.Describedly take turns 2, locking device 3, movable axis 4, gearbox 5 and magnetic-clutch motor 6 be arranged on framework 1.Described movable axis 4 connects magnetic-clutch motor 6, between magnetic-clutch motor 6 and movable axis 4, gearbox 5 is set.Gearbox 5 is used for changing the size of velocity of rotation; Movable axis 4 is used for transmission power and change the direction of power, driven wheel 2 motions; Magnetic-clutch motor 6 plays and transmits the acting effect, is that the source of strength is provided in the whole course of work, is also controlling the time of stopping simultaneously.By adopting electromagnetic clutch motor 6, when bending machine moved to desired location, outage was rapidly in time stopped, and prevented that radius from appearring in the copper pipe bending part excessive, too small or roll over flat phenomenon.So just solved general elbow owner axle running speed fast, torsion is less, the untimely problem of stopping.
